CSV Reader Benchmarks

The CSV benchmarks measure processing the contents of a 65k record CSV file containing "SalesRecord" data. This data set does not include any quoted fields, and thus does not test correctness of any implementation.

Strongly-Typed Access

This first benchmark set measures accessing CSV data in a strongly-typed way. Some libraries provide optimized access to typed field values, while other only provide access to fields as strings and require the user to parse as appropriate. Strongly typed access can avoid allocating an intermediary string and potentially parse the value out of an internal buffer.

The "X2" and "X4" suffix indicate the degree of paralleization used. The RecordParser library employs parallelization in the processing of CSV records, so while RecordParser's X4 processing is the fastest, it comes at the cost of higher CPU utilization.

Each benchmark contains an "Auto" or "Manual" suffix, indicating whether the library's automatic binder was used, or whether the binder was written manually. The SylvanDapperAuto benchmark uses the generic DbDataReader binder provided by the popular Dapper library and is meant to compare the performance of the Sylvan automatic generic binder.

String-Only Access

This benchmark set measures CSV readers processing every field in the dataset as a string, which is the most basic functionality common to all CSV parsers. Typically, string values would subsequently be parsed into a strongly-typed value, so this benchmark might not be representative of a real-world use case, since in many cases using strongly-typed access would be more convenient and also faster.

CsvSum

This benchmark measures summing the values of a single column (Total Profit) from the CSV file. It is meant to highlight an optimization employed by some libraries where you only "pay" for the columns that you access.
